导读:MySQL是一种流行的关系型数据库管理系统 , 但在使用过程中可能会遇到缺少扩展的情况 。本文将介绍一些常见的MySQL扩展及其作用 。
1. mysqli扩展
mysqli扩展是MySQL官方提供的PHP扩展,可以用于连接MySQL数据库并执行SQL语句 。相比于旧版的mysql扩展 , mysqli支持更多的功能和特性,如事务处理、存储过程等 。
2. pdo_mysql扩展
pdo_mysql扩展是PHP的PDO(PHP数据对象)扩展中的一个驱动程序,可以用于连接MySQL数据库 。与mysqli扩展相比,pdo_mysql更加通用,可以支持多种数据库类型,包括MySQL、PostgreSQL等 。
3. memcached扩展
memcached扩展可以将MySQL查询结果存储在内存中,以提高查询速度 。使用memcached扩展需要先安装和配置memcached服务器 。
4. redis扩展
redis扩展也可以用于缓存MySQL查询结果,但与memcached不同的是,redis支持更多的数据结构和操作方式,并且可以实现分布式缓存 。
【mysql 缺少dll mysql缺少扩展】总结:MySQL缺少扩展可能会影响到应用程序的性能和功能 。以上介绍的几种扩展都可以提高MySQL的性能和可用性,开发者可以根据实际需求选择合适的扩展来使用 。
推荐阅读
- mysql中的隔离级别 mysql四中隔离级别
- mysql授予权限命令 mysql为表中的列授权
- mysql普通降序索引
- mysql锁表场景 mysql会锁表怎么设置
- mysql如何查询表数据 mysql查询表格数
- 删除mysql数据库数据 删除mysql数据库缓存